RAPOO Keyboard and Mouse Wireless - 9010M Multi-Device Wireless Keyboard Mouse C vs ProtoArc Wireless Keyboard and Mouse Combo
Price Comparison
When it comes to pricing, the RAPOO Keyboard and Mouse Wireless - 9010M Multi-Device Wireless Keyboard Mouse C retails for C$39.98, making it a more budget-friendly option compared to the ProtoArc Wireless Keyboard and Mouse Combo, priced at C$69.99. The difference of C$30.01 could be significant for consumers looking for an economical choice without compromising on essential features. While the RAPOO option offers a solid performance for its price point, the ProtoArc's higher cost might be justified by its additional ergonomic features and build quality.
Device Compatibility
The RAPOO Keyboard and Mouse combo supports seamless connectivity with up to four devices simultaneously via 2.4GHz and Bluetooth 5.0/4.0, making it highly versatile for users who juggle multiple platforms. In contrast, the ProtoArc allows you to switch between three devices using both 2.4GHz and Bluetooth, but its compatibility is limited as the 2.4G channel only supports Windows systems, while Bluetooth is compatible with a broader range of devices, including Mac and Android. This means that while both products cater to multi-device users, the RAPOO has a slight edge in terms of the number of devices it can connect to at once.
Ergonomics and Comfort
The ProtoArc Wireless Keyboard and Mouse Combo is designed with comfort in mind, featuring a non-removable wrist rest that helps alleviate wrist strain during extended typing sessions. This ergonomic design is complemented by an adjustable stand for optimal height. On the other hand, the RAPOO focuses more on portability with its ultra-thin design, making it lightweight and easy to carry. While both products prioritize user comfort, the ProtoArc's dedicated ergonomic features may be more appealing for those who spend long hours at their desks.
Battery Life and Power Source
The RAPOO combo is battery-powered and utilizes upgraded Bluetooth technology to extend battery life, although specific battery life details are not provided. In contrast, the ProtoArc features built-in lithium batteries (500mAh for the keyboard and 300mAh for the mouse), which can be recharged via a Type-C cable. This rechargeable feature eliminates the need for constant battery replacements, making the ProtoArc a more sustainable choice. The smart power-saving mode that activates after 60 minutes of inactivity further enhances its energy efficiency.
Typing Experience
The typing experience on the RAPOO Keyboard is enhanced by its low-profile chiclet scissor keys, which provide a comfortable and quiet typing experience. However, it does not have a wrist rest, which might affect long-term comfort. The ProtoArc, with its responsive scissor switch and dedicated wrist rest, offers a more cushioned typing experience that could benefit those who type extensively. Additionally, the ProtoArc's full-size layout, including a numeric keypad and multimedia shortcut keys, further enhances productivity, especially for users who need quick access to functions.
Mouse Functionality
The RAPOO mouse features adjustable DPI settings (800/1000/1200/1600/2400), allowing for customizable sensitivity across different surfaces. This flexibility is great for users seeking precision in their tasks. The ProtoArc mouse also offers adjustable DPI levels (1000/1600/2400), providing a similar level of customization. Both mice are designed for quiet operation, but the RAPOO's ability to connect to two devices simultaneously may offer added convenience for users who switch between tasks frequently.

Which should you buy?
In deciding between the RAPOO Keyboard and Mouse Wireless - 9010M and the ProtoArc Wireless Keyboard and Mouse Combo, your choice will largely depend on your specific needs. If you're looking for a budget-friendly option with multi-device connectivity and solid performance, the RAPOO is an excellent choice at C$39.98. However, if you prioritise comfort for long typing sessions, rechargeable functionality, and a more premium feel, the ProtoArc, priced at C$69.99, may be worth the investment. Ultimately, both products offer valuable features, catering to different user preferences and work styles.
